Choosing the right
printer for your needs
It is a daunting task to choose a
printer without deciding
what type you really require. You have
to choose between an
ink jet and a laser printer. After that
you have to decide
on the printer size essential for the
tasks you require it
to accomplish. You have to consider
factors such as printer
type, size, running costs and price and
service
availability.
There are mainly two types of printers
in the market. The
laser printers and inkjet printers are
the only two choices
available in the market. In the laser
printer a laser beam
is used to print the picture on the
drum which is then
transferred on to the paper. In the
inkjet printer,
however, ink is sprayed through tiny
jets on to the page
forming the image on the page. The
difference between the
two types of printers is the basic
difference in the
technology involved in them.
As far as utility is concerned inkjet
printers can do only
small jobs whereas laser printers can
take heavy loads of
work. Inkjet printers can do a variety
of jobs such as
printing anything from spreadsheets to
brochures to word
documents to photos. They are ideal for
printing business
and professional documents that are not
so expensive, on a
small quantity. These printers are made
to take small print
volumes. Hence, they are not costly and
can be easily
accommodated in every
budget.
In terms of size ink jet printers are
usually small and
lightweight and some come with carry
cases for
portability. This makes them ideal
partners for laptops
and PDAs and any other devices that
require printing
facilities.
